[v3,2/3] virtio-iommu: Add a granule property

Message ID 20240221205926.40066-3-eric.auger@redhat.com
State New
Headers show
Series VIRTIO-IOMMU: Set default granule to host page size | expand

Commit Message

Eric Auger Feb. 21, 2024, 8:58 p.m. UTC
This allows to choose which granule will be used by
default by the virtio-iommu. Current default is 4K.

diff --git a/hw/virtio/virtio-iommu.c b/hw/virtio/virtio-iommu.c
index 2ce5839c60..1eded09134 100644
--- a/hw/virtio/virtio-iommu.c
+++ b/hw/virtio/virtio-iommu.c
@@ -1125,8 +1125,8 @@  static int virtio_iommu_notify_flag_changed(IOMMUMemoryRegion *iommu_mr,
 }
 
 /*
- * The default mask (TARGET_PAGE_MASK) is the smallest supported guest granule,
- * for example 0xfffffffffffff000. When an assigned device has page size
+ * The default mask depends on the "granule" property. For example, with
+ * 4K granule, it is ~0xFFF. When an assigned device has page size
  * restrictions due to the hardware IOMMU configuration, apply this restriction
  * to the mask.
  */
@@ -1323,7 +1323,23 @@  static void virtio_iommu_device_realize(DeviceState *dev, Error **errp)
      * in vfio realize
      */
     s->config.bypass = s->boot_bypass;
-    s->config.page_size_mask = qemu_target_page_mask();
+
+    switch (s->granule_mode) {
+    case GRANULE_MODE_4K:
+        s->config.page_size_mask = ~0xFFF;
+        break;
+    case GRANULE_MODE_16K:
+        s->config.page_size_mask = ~0x3FFF;
+        break;
+    case GRANULE_MODE_64K:
+        s->config.page_size_mask = ~0xFFFF;
+        break;
+    case GRANULE_MODE_HOST:
+        s->config.page_size_mask = qemu_real_host_page_mask();
+        break;
+    default:
+        error_setg(errp, "Unsupported granule mode");
+    }
     if (s->aw_bits < 32 || s->aw_bits > 64) {
         error_setg(errp, "aw-bits must be within [32,64]");
     }
@@ -1537,6 +1553,8 @@  static Property virtio_iommu_properties[] = {
                      TYPE_PCI_BUS, PCIBus *),
     DEFINE_PROP_BOOL("boot-bypass", VirtIOIOMMU, boot_bypass, true),
     DEFINE_PROP_UINT8("aw-bits", VirtIOIOMMU, aw_bits, 0),
+    DEFINE_PROP_GRANULE_MODE("granule", VirtIOIOMMU, granule_mode,
+                             GRANULE_MODE_4K),
     DEFINE_PROP_END_OF_LIST(),
 };
 
diff --git a/qemu-options.hx b/qemu-options.hx
index a98bc7bd60..6ae27c2cff 100644
--- a/qemu-options.hx
+++ b/qemu-options.hx
@@ -1179,6 +1179,9 @@  SRST
     ``aw-bits=val`` (val between 32 and 64, default depends on machine)
         This decides the address width of IOVA address space. It defaults
         to 39 bits on q35 machines and 48 bits on ARM virt machines.
+    ``granule=val`` (possible values are 4K, 16K, 64K and host)
+        This decides the default granule to be be exposed by the
+        virtio-iommu. If host, the granule is the same as the host page size.
 
 ERST
